[quote=Anonymous]As we all know, there are Americans who eat healthily and there are Americans who eat poorly. I'm sure the exact same can be said for Indians. One family may douse everything in ghee, others will be ascetic when it comes to food. I've eaten enough Indian home cooking to know that there's lots and lots of both. And obesity is definitely a growing problem among middle class Indians and so many men have the potbellies from a high carbohydrate diet with rice and too much refined rice can lead to diabetes (along with others). And let's not even get into typical Indian sweets. Indians *love* their sweets and it is possibly the most intensely sweet, sugary, sweets in the world. [/quote]
